Event: 03/13/2001
Eight Employees Asphyxiated In Chemical Release

Eight employees were asphyxiated when a high pH waste liquid containing selenides (a form of the non-metallic element selenium) was acidified. This generated hydrogen selenide (selenic acid) gas which was released into the atmosphere. Seven of the employees were hospitalized and one was treated but not hospitalized.
